Balm and Dover are places in Florida. This page compares them across population, income, housing, education, commuting, and how each has changed since 2019.

Balm has the higher population (5,362 vs 3,157 in Dover). Balm has the higher median household income ($104,347 vs $42,222 in Dover). Balm has the higher median home value ($312,600 vs $215,500 in Dover).
